Role Summary/ Essential Responsibilities

This role involves primarily the deburring and hand fitting of high value and complex aerospace components using handheld electrical and pneumatic deburring tools performing operations in line with aerospace specifications and procedures.

This role will also require flexibility to cover all other TSO requirements which will include but not limited to Assembly, Test and Surface Treatments.
